Brockholes to Pentre-Bach by train

A train trip from Brockholes to Pentre-Bach takes about 7hrs 39 mins on average, covering roughly 145 miles (234 kilometres). With around 15 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£29.40,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

What are my cheap ticket options for Brockholes to Pentre-Bach journeys?

From booking in Advance, to our FairSplits, here are our tips for you to find the best price

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Brockholes to Pentre-Bach start from as little as £29.40

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Brockholes to Pentre-Bach are available for £103.10 one way, or £345.10 return

Station Details & Facilities

At Pentre-Bach, purchasing and collecting tickets is straightforward. While there isn't a staffed ticket office, ticket machines are available for customers to collect pre-purchased tickets. These machines support major debit and credit card transactions but do not accept cash. Smartcard validators are installed, offering modern convenience for travelers familiar with digital ticketing systems.

Accessibility is a priority at Pentre-Bach. The station is categorized as Accessible (Category A), with step-free access from the main road to the platform, catering to passengers with mobility challenges. However, it’s worth noting that there are no accessible toilets or designated waiting rooms, though seating areas are provided. Cyclists are welcomed with four sheltered bike spaces monitored by CCTV, ensuring that bicycle storage is secure.

Onward Travel Options

Pentre-Bach facilitates easy onward travel for passengers. For those reliant on buses, the nearest stops are conveniently located on Merthyr Road, offering significant connectivity with local routes. Additionally, the rail replacement bus service also stops nearby the station entrance, ensuring continued mobility in case of any disruptions. Although direct taxi services and car hire options may not be available at the station itself, the location’s connectivity supports alternative travel arrangements.
